[0026] The present invention will be described in detail below in conjunction with the accompanying drawings.

[0027] 1. Treatment of pumpkin samples and determination of extraction conditions: Wash the pumpkins, peel them, remove their flesh, crush them with a pulverizer, stir them evenly, freeze them at a low temperature for 3 hours, and then use ultrasonic-assisted extraction. The extraction temperature is 60°C, and the ultrasonic power is 200W. The extraction time is 30min, and the ratio of solid to liquid is 1:30.

[0028] 1.1 The effect of freezing temperature on the extraction rate of pumpkin polysaccharides

[0029] The extraction rates of pumpkin polysaccharides under different freezing temperatures are shown in figure 1 . Abstract

The invention discloses an extraction and purification method of pumpkin polysaccharide. The method includes the steps of conducting cleaning, peeling and pulp discarding on pumpkin, smashing the pumpkin through a smashing machine, conducting even stirring and low-temperature freezing, then extracting pumpkin polysaccharide with the aid of ultrasonic waves to obtain a pumpkin polysaccharide extraction solution, adding polyethylene glycol and ammonium sulfate to the pumpkin polysaccharide extraction solution for extraction, conducting sufficient and even stirring, standing till phase separation is completed, conducting centrifugal separation to form two phases of the solution, adding absolute ethyl alcohol to the upper phase, and conducting sedimentation to obtain pumpkin polysaccharide. The method has the advantages of saving time, being efficient, saving energy and the like when ultrasonic waves are used for extracting pumpkin polysaccharide. The inactivation or degeneration of bioactive substances can not be caused when extraction is conducted in a water solution. The yield of pumpkin polysaccharide in the method can reach 60.58-62.82%. The phase separation time is short, and the natural phase separation time is usually 5-15 min. No organic matter residual problem exists, and engineering amplification and continuous operation are easy.

technical field [0001] The invention relates to biotechnology, in particular to pumpkin polysaccharide and its extraction and purification method. Background technique [0002] Pumpkin, also known as pumpkin, pumpkin, pumpkin, etc., is an annual vine herb of Cucurbitaceae, and is one of the important medicinal and edible plants. Pumpkin is rich in nutrition, not only contains mannitol, a variety of amino acids, vitamin C, E and trace elements Fe, Se, Zn, Mn, etc., but also contains a large number of active ingredients such as alkaloids, cucurbitine, and pectin. [0003] Pumpkin polysaccharide is a non-specific immune enhancer, which can improve the immune function of the body, promote the production of cytokines, and play a variety of regulatory functions on the immune system by activating complement and other ways.
